The Premier League’s match weekend twenty-four is here, and more crucial fixtures will have all sides aiming to get victories.
The Premier League has its twenty-fourth match weekend, full of vital games where teams will encounter big tasks.
Last time, Manchester City got a win against Wolves, and Aston Villa did as well against Newcastle, while a defeat for Arsenal by Manchester United meant their gap was decreased.
Chelsea made it into the top five, and United went on to a higher placement, with Liverpool at the expense. Newcastle, Fulham, and Sunderland are among the sides competing with them.
In relegation, Wolves, Burnley and West ham remain within, but they look to gain themselves points and produce something to help them stay in the PL. Nottingham Forest, Leeds, Crystal Palace and Tottenham are also in possible threat.
The games will have Aston Villa vs Brentford, Sunderland vs Burnley, and Tottenham vs Manchester City.
The next match weekend will be on the 6th, 7th and 8th of February.
As Arsenal attempt to keep their lead intact, the Cityzens and Villa will be doing the opposite by attempting to reduce their distance even further and cement themselves as actual contenders to take over the Gunners in this title race.
